Legal consultants differ from advocates or litigators in that they primarily offer legal advice rather than representing clients in court. Their services include drafting contracts, reviewing legal documents, advising on regulatory requirements, and assisting in dispute resolution. In Dubai, where the legal system is influenced by a combination of Sharia law, UAE federal law, and common law practices—particularly in free zones like the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C)—legal consultants provide the clarity and understanding clients need to navigate with confidence.

One of the most common areas where legal consultants in Dubai are engaged is corporate and commercial law. From business formation and licensing to mergers, acquisitions, and joint ventures, legal consultants help entrepreneurs and multinational corporations establish a strong legal foundation. They ensure that all agreements comply with local regulations and international standards, reducing the risk of legal issues down the line. In a city where regulations can change rapidly, having a legal consultant who stays up to date with the latest laws is a valuable asset for any business.
Legal consultants also play a key role in real estate and property law. Dubai’s real estate sector is one of the most dynamic in the world, and investors—both local and international—require sound legal advice to safeguard their interests. Legal consultants assist clients with drafting and reviewing lease agreements, purchase contracts, and property registration. They also provide legal due diligence before any major transaction, helping clients avoid disputes and ensure smooth transactions in a highly competitive market.
Another vital area of legal consultancy in Dubai is family and personal law. Expatriates, who make up a significant portion of Dubai’s population, often face complex legal matters involving marriage, divorce, child custody, and inheritance. Legal consultants help clients understand the implications of UAE laws on their personal situations and ensure that their rights and obligations are clearly defined. They also guide individuals through processes such as writing wills, setting up trusts, or managing guardianship issues.
In addition to these specialized fields, many legal consultants in Dubai are involved in regulatory compliance, employment law, and dispute resolution. With the UAE government placing a strong emphasis on legal reform and transparency, businesses are under increasing pressure to meet compliance requirements. Legal consultants help companies navigate labor laws, draft employment contracts, resolve workplace disputes, and ensure adherence to commercial codes. In many cases, they act as intermediaries between clients and government authorities, streamlining administrative procedures.
